| 1 | +using UnityEngine; |
| 2 | + |
| 3 | +namespace Zigurous.UI |
| 4 | +{ |
| 5 | + /// <summary> |
| 6 | + /// Extension methods for RectTransform. |
| 7 | + /// </summary> |
| 8 | + public static class RectTransformExtensions |
| 9 | + { |
| 10 | + /// <summary> |
| 11 | + /// Sets the width of the rect transform to the given value. |
| 12 | + /// </summary> |
| 13 | + /// <param name="rect">The rect transform to update.</param> |
| 14 | + /// <param name="width">The width value to set.</param> |
| 15 | + public static void SetWidth(this RectTransform rect, float width) => |
| 16 | + rect.sizeDelta = new Vector2(width, rect.sizeDelta.y); |
| 17 | + |
| 18 | + /// <summary> |
| 19 | + /// Sets the height of the rect transform to the given value. |
| 20 | + /// </summary> |
| 21 | + /// <param name="rect">The rect transform to update.</param> |
| 22 | + /// <param name="height">The height value to set.</param> |
| 23 | + public static void SetHeight(this RectTransform rect, float height) => |
| 24 | + rect.sizeDelta = new Vector2(rect.sizeDelta.x, height); |
| 25 | + |
| 26 | + /// <summary> |
| 27 | + /// Sets the left offset of the rect transform to the given value. |
| 28 | + /// </summary> |
| 29 | + /// <param name="rect">The rect transform to update.</param> |
| 30 | + /// <param name="left">The left offset value to set.</param> |
| 31 | + public static void SetLeft(this RectTransform rect, float left) => |
| 32 | + rect.offsetMin = new Vector2(left, rect.offsetMin.y); |
| 33 | + |
| 34 | + /// <summary> |
| 35 | + /// Sets the right offset of the rect transform to the given value. |
| 36 | + /// </summary> |
| 37 | + /// <param name="rect">The rect transform to update.</param> |
| 38 | + /// <param name="right">The right offset value to set.</param> |
| 39 | + public static void SetRight(this RectTransform rect, float right) => |
| 40 | + rect.offsetMax = new Vector2(-right, rect.offsetMax.y); |
| 41 | + |
| 42 | + /// <summary> |
| 43 | + /// Sets the top offset of the rect transform to the given value. |
| 44 | + /// </summary> |
| 45 | + /// <param name="rect">The rect transform to update.</param> |
| 46 | + /// <param name="top">The top offset value to set.</param> |
| 47 | + public static void SetTop(this RectTransform rect, float top) => |
| 48 | + rect.offsetMax = new Vector2(rect.offsetMax.x, -top); |
| 49 | + |
| 50 | + /// <summary> |
| 51 | + /// Sets the bottom offset of the rect transform to the given value. |
| 52 | + /// </summary> |
| 53 | + /// <param name="rect">The rect transform to update.</param> |
| 54 | + /// <param name="bottom">The bottom offset value to set.</param> |
| 55 | + public static void SetBottom(this RectTransform rect, float bottom) => |
| 56 | + rect.offsetMin = new Vector2(rect.offsetMin.x, bottom); |
| 57 | + |
| 58 | + /// <summary> |
| 59 | + /// Sets the left anchor of the rect transform to the given value. |
| 60 | + /// </summary> |
| 61 | + /// <param name="rect">The rect transform to update.</param> |
| 62 | + /// <param name="minX">The left anchor value to set.</param> |
| 63 | + public static void SetAnchorMinX(this RectTransform rect, float minX) => |
| 64 | + rect.anchorMin = new Vector2(minX, rect.anchorMin.y); |
| 65 | + |
| 66 | + /// <summary> |
| 67 | + /// Sets the bottom anchor of the rect transform to the given value. |
| 68 | + /// </summary> |
| 69 | + /// <param name="rect">The rect transform to update.</param> |
| 70 | + /// <param name="minY">The bottom anchor value to set.</param> |
| 71 | + public static void SetAnchorMinY(this RectTransform rect, float minY) => |
| 72 | + rect.anchorMin = new Vector2(rect.anchorMin.x, minY); |
| 73 | + |
| 74 | + /// <summary> |
| 75 | + /// Sets the right anchor of the rect transform to the given value. |
| 76 | + /// </summary> |
| 77 | + /// <param name="rect">The rect transform to update.</param> |
| 78 | + /// <param name="maxX">The right anchor value to set.</param> |
| 79 | + public static void SetAnchorMaxX(this RectTransform rect, float maxX) => |
| 80 | + rect.anchorMax = new Vector2(maxX, rect.anchorMax.y); |
| 81 | + |
| 82 | + /// <summary> |
| 83 | + /// Sets the top anchor of the rect transform to the given value. |
| 84 | + /// </summary> |
| 85 | + /// <param name="rect">The rect transform to update.</param> |
| 86 | + /// <param name="maxY">The top anchor value to set.</param> |
| 87 | + public static void SetAnchorMaxY(this RectTransform rect, float maxY) => |
| 88 | + rect.anchorMax = new Vector2(rect.anchorMax.x, maxY); |
| 89 | + |
| 90 | + } |
| 91 | + |
| 92 | +} |
